Characterization of eight polymorphic loci for Maasai giraffe (Giraffa camelopardalis tippelskirchi) using non-invasive genetic samples


Crowhurst RS, Mullins TD, Mutayoba BM, Epps CW.

We used Illumina sequencing to develop eight novel microsatellite loci for Maasai giraffe (Giraffa camelopardalis tippelskirchi), and screened them using fecal DNA. Genetic diversity was assessed for 40 individuals from the Katavi National Park/Rukwa Game Reserve ecosystem in Tanzania. The number of alleles per locus ranged from 2 to 14 (mean = 6.2) and mean expected heterozygosity was moderate (range 0.025–0.838, mean = 0.527). These markers were successfully tested using degraded DNA and may be useful for future studies of giraffe, especially those that use non-invasive sampling techniques.
